OpenAI has announced the launch of a significant initiative aimed at empowering U.S. nonprofits through the introduction of the People-First AI Fund, which will allocate $50 million to support impactful projects. This funding is targeted at organizations that leverage artificial intelligence to address critical issues in diverse sectors such as education, healthcare, and research. With grant applications set to open from September 8 to October 8, 2025, eligible nonprofits are encouraged to apply for financial assistance to enhance their AI-driven initiatives.
This move is part of OpenAI's broader strategy to promote the ethical use of AI technology for social improvement. By investing in nonprofits, OpenAI aims to foster innovation and maximize the reach of AI applications in solving societal challenges. The fund represents a commitment to aligning technology development with the needs of communities, ensuring that advancements in AI are accessible and beneficial to all.
